- The iconic layout of the city’s construction includes many hotels built near the popular convention centers to accommodate guests. The popular Moscone Center has nearby hotels like InterContinental San Francisco, Marriott Marquis San Francisco, and W San Francisco. The popular Fort Mason Center for Arts & Culture has nearby hotels like Cow Hollow Motor Inn and Golden Gate Inn.
- Due to the many trade shows in San Francisco throughout the year, there are many convention centers available. Some of the most notable ones are Moscone Center, Fort Mason Center for Arts & Culture, San Francisco Design Center, and Yerba Buena Center for the Arts.
